In 2004, the science fiction film "I, Robot" was released, captivating audiences with its portrayal of a future where robots and artificial intelligence (AI) are integral to everyday life. The movie, based on Isaac Asimov's collection of short stories of the same name, explores the complex relationships between humans and robots, raising important questions about the ethics and consequences of creating intelligent machines. The Open Matte 1080p BluRay x265 HEVC release of "I, Robot" (2004) offers a high-quality viewing experience, with a resolution of 1920x1080 pixels and a frame rate of 24 fps. The x265 HEVC (High Efficiency Video Coding) codec provides an efficient compression of the video stream, resulting in a relatively small file size of approximately 4.5 GB.
